Why You Need a DIY Trampoline Tent?

Before we talk about the trampoline tent construction process, let’s discuss first the benefits of having it.

Weather Protection

Trampoline tents provide a shaded area on hot summer days. So, you and your kids can enjoy jumping on the trampoline without worrying about getting sunburnt. The tent also provides shelter from the rain, snow, and other bad weather. Hence you can use your trampoline throughout the year.

Kids Play Zone

A tent on the trampoline adds excitement to your backyard, especially for the children. Kids love to spend time on their own and the trampoline tent allows them to do that. They can play, sleep, read, and do many more activities here throughout the day.

Parties and Sleepovers

Trampoline tents are a perfect place to arrange parties and enjoy sleepovers. You can invite your friends there and do lots of fun there. The shade over you will give you extra comfort and safety on the outside.

Step-by-Step Guide on How to Make DIY Trampoline Tent

diy-trampoline-tentHere’s a step-by-step guide on how to create your own DIY trampoline tent.

Step 1: Gather Necessary Things for Trampoline Tent

You’ll need a few supplies to build a tent for the trampoline including

  • Trampoline
  • Fabric
  • Tent poles
  • Bungee cords

You can use any type of fabric for the tent, such as canvas, nylon, or even an old bedsheet. But, make sure it’s durable and can withstand harsh weather. And it’s recommended to choose a small trampoline as this is quite difficult to make a strong tent for a large trampoline.

Step 2: Mark the Center of the Trampoline

Now you have to mark the trampoline center using a measuring tape and a pen or chalk. This will be the point where you’ll join the tent poles together.

Step 3: Attach the Tent Poles to the Trampoline

Now assemble the tent poles together and attach them to the trampoline poles. After that bend the tent poles to form a dome shape. Then tie the tent poles with trampoline posts using bungee cords. And fix all the poles together in the middle of the trampoline overhead.

Tips: Most tent poles are made of lightweight, sturdy materials such as aluminum or fiberglass. You can also use thick rods available in the brick-and-mortar shop or online. But make sure they can be bent to build the tent.

Step 4: Drape the Fabric Over the Tent Poles

It’s time to spread the fabric over the assembled tent poles. Be sure, it’s evenly distributed. Then, tie the fabric to the tent poles well using bungee cords. So, the trampoline tent is almost ready to go.

Step 5: Add Any Additional Features

diy-trampoline-tent-projectsIf you want, you can customize your trampoline tent by adding more features such as windows, doors, sidewalls, surrounding nets, or even a zipper for securing entry and exit. You can use Velcro, buttons, or zippers to attach these features to the sidewalls or net of the newly made tent.
